Image Matching Game Method And Apparatus

US Patent:
6346043, Feb 12, 2002
Filed:
Sep 13, 1999
Appl. No.:
09/395034
Inventors:
Brian F. Colin - Homewood IL
Jeffry L. Nauman - Hinckley IL
Assignee:
International Game Technology - Reno NV
International Classification:
A63F 922
US Classification:
463 17, 463 18, 463 19, 463 20, 463 16, 463 9, 273273
Abstract:
An image matching gaming method suitable for use as bonus game on a slot machine is provided. The method includes allowing the player to have an active role in selecting the bonus award. The player is allowed to see all the awards associated with possible selection after his choices have been made.

Assymetric Dice Game

US Patent:
2003010, Jun 5, 2003
Filed:
Sep 3, 2002
Appl. No.:
10/233985
Inventors:
Brian Colin - Homewood IL, US
International Classification:
A63F009/24
A63F013/00
G06F017/00
G06F019/00
US Classification:
463/022000
Abstract:
A method and apparatus are provided for playing a video game of chance by a player using an asymmetrical die. The method includes the steps randomly determining a side on which the asymmetrical die will land based upon a predetermined landing odds for each side of the asymmetrical die in response to a request to roll the asymmetrical die, displaying an image of the asymmetrical die lying on the randomly determined side and determining a payout to the player based upon a predetermined payout factor for the randomly determined side.
